Understanding FSU Game Broadcast Rights

Florida State University’s football games are primarily broadcast on a network of partners, including major networks like ABC, ESPN, and the ACC Network. The specific network broadcasting a particular game depends on a variety of factors, including the opponent, the time of year, and existing broadcast agreements. Streaming Options for FSU Games

In today’s digital age, streaming provides an increasingly popular way to watch FSU games. Several platforms offer live streaming of college football games, including:

  • ESPN+: ESPN’s streaming service offers a wide selection of college football games, including some FSU matchups.

  • Hulu + Live TV: This streaming bundle provides access to live television channels, which may include networks broadcasting FSU games.

  • YouTube TV: Similar to Hulu + Live TV, YouTube TV offers access to live TV channels that might carry FSU games.

  • fuboTV: Another streaming service with a focus on live sports, fuboTV can be a viable option for watching FSU games.

  • Sling TV: Sling TV offers a more customizable package of channels and might include networks that broadcast FSU games, depending on your selected plan.

Remember to check each platform’s availability and coverage for FSU games in your specific region.

What if the FSU Game Isn’t Televised?

Sometimes, despite your best efforts, you might find that a particular FSU game isn’t televised. In such cases, you still have options:

  • Radio Broadcasts: FSU games are also broadcast on the radio. The Seminole Sports Network provides extensive radio coverage, and you can often find local radio affiliates carrying the games.

  • Live Stats and Updates: Several websites and apps offer live stats and play-by-play updates for college football games. While not a replacement for watching the game live, this can help you stay engaged.
